Chicken Kosha is a traditional Bengali dish known for its robust flavors and rich, spicy gravy. The dish features marinated chicken pieces that are sautéed and slow-cooked in a fragrant blend of spices, making it a hearty and comforting meal. The preparation typically begins with marinating the chicken in yogurt, turmeric, and red chili powder, which helps tenderize the meat and infuse it with flavor. The cooking process involves frying onions until golden brown, followed by the addition of ginger-garlic paste, tomatoes, and a mix of spices such as cumin, coriander, and garam masala. This forms a thick, aromatic sauce that clings to the chicken. Slow-cooking allows the flavors to meld beautifully, resulting in tender, juicy chicken immersed in a savory, slightly spicy gravy. Chicken Kosha is often garnished with fresh cilantro and served with steamed rice, luchi (fried bread), or paratha, making it a perfect centerpiece for a Bengali meal. Each bite offers a delicious combination of rich spices, tender chicken, and a hearty sauce that is both comforting and satisfying.
